A GST return is a type of tax document that records a company’s purchases, sales, input tax credit (tax paid on purchases), and output tax credit (tax paid on sales). Simply put, the GST return meaning is that it acts as a formal declaration of income and expenses under the Goods and Services Tax system.

Before the introduction of GST, businesses had to deal with multiple taxes like service tax, excise duty, VAT, customs duty, and purchase tax. Each required separate filing, making the process tedious. The implementation of GST simplified this by bringing everything under one unified tax system.

A GST return has to be filed online, and the process can only be done once a business is registered under GST and has a valid GST number.

Who Should File GST Returns?

Any person or business registered under the GST system with a GST number must file returns. It is a mandatory compliance for all GST-registered entities.

You need to file GST returns for the following transactions:

  • Purchases
  • Input Tax Credit on all purchases
  • Sales
  • Output Tax Credit on sales

The different types of GST returns depends on your business turnover and the scheme opted:

  • Businesses with turnover above ₹5 crore: 24 monthly returns + 1 annual return (if not under QRMP).
  • Businesses with turnover up to ₹5 crore under QRMP scheme: 9 returns + 1 annual return.
  • Businesses under composition scheme: 4 quarterly returns + 1 annual return.

How to File GST Returns Online?

Many first-time taxpayers ask: how to file GST returns online? The process is simple if you follow these steps:

  1. Visit www.gst.gov.in
  2. Click on Login and enter your GST username and password.
  3. Go to Services → Returns Dashboard.
  4. Select the Financial Year and return filing period.
  5. Choose the form based on the types of GST returns available.
  6. Fill in all details carefully. (This is essentially how to fill GST return forms correctly).
  7. Save, then submit.
  8. Check balances, make payments if necessary.
  9. Verify using EVC or DSC, then proceed.

This entire process explains how to submit GST return online securely and within deadlines.

Types of GST Returns

There are different types of GST returns, and the one you file depends on your business type, turnover, and transaction category. For instance:

  • GSTR-1: For reporting outward supplies (sales).
  • GSTR-3B: Monthly self-declared summary return.
  • GSTR-9: Annual return.
  • GSTR-4: For taxpayers under the composition scheme.

Each return serves a unique purpose, ensuring accurate reporting of transactions under GST.
